> There are a number of users of the clang static analyser back-end for
> intelligent code completion. Irony-Mode for emacs, for example. For a while
> people have been reporting an issue with not getting completions for
> protected members of parent classes and I believe this patch solves the
> bug: simply that the arguments to IsDerivedFromInclusive were the wrong way
> around.
